How are MPAA ratings determined?
Ratings are assigned by a board of parents who consider factors such as violence, sex, language and drug use, then assign a rating they believe the majority of American parents would give a movie.

How bad is TV-14?
It is equivalent to the MPAA film rating PG-13. Content may be unsuitable for minors younger than 14 years of age. This rating contains violence, sexual references (including censored and/or partial nudity, medium to high-level implied scenes of sexual intercourse, and sexual innuendo) and strong language.
What makes a show TV-14?
Programs rated TV-14 contain material that parents or adult guardians may find unsuitable for children under the age of 14.
How bad is TV-MA rating?
TV-MA – TV Mature Audience Only This program is specifically designed to be viewed by adults and therefore may be unsuitable for children under 17. Content Ratings Content Ratings are shown just below the program rating.

What are all the movie ratings?
The five movie rating categories are: G, or General Audience. PG, or Parental Guidance Suggested. PG-13, or Parents Strongly Cautioned. R, or Restricted. NC-17, or No One 17 and Under Admitted.
What is the American film rating system?
The Motion Picture Association of America (MPAA) film rating system is used in the United States and its territories to rate a film ‘s suitability for certain audiences based on its content.
What is a motion picture rating?
Motion picture content rating system. A motion picture content rating system is designated to classify films with regard to suitability for audiences in terms of issues such as sex, violence, substance abuse, profanity, impudence or other types of mature content.
